E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
二叉树的深度优先遍历
力扣刷题之旅:进阶篇(二)
一、广度
优先
搜索(BFS)下面是一个使用BFS算法解决“图的
遍历
”问题的简单代码示例:fromcollection
GT开发算法工程师
·
2024-02-09 13:26
leetcode
算法
职场和发展
数据结构
【数据结构】二叉树的顺序结构及链式结构
表示文件系统的目录树结构)2.二叉树概念及结构2.1二叉树的概念2.2现实中的二叉树编辑2.3特殊的二叉树2.4二叉树的性质2.5二叉树的存储结构3.二叉树链式结构的实现3.1二叉树的创建3.2二叉树的
遍历
romantic+
·
2024-02-09 12:43
C数据结构
数据结构
排序算法---冒泡排序
欢迎点赞收藏~冒泡排序是一种简单的排序算法,其原理是重复地比较相邻的两个元素,并将顺序不正确的元素进行交换,使得每次
遍历
都能将一个最大(或最小)的元素放到末尾。通过多次
遍历
,最终实现整个序列的排序。
快乐至上
·
2024-02-09 12:43
排序算法
算法
数据结构
来一碗鸡汤敬鬼神
故事以“我有一个朋友/闺蜜/男友”开头,论点要有争论性,最好结合时事热点,一切阅读量
优先
。让我反思的是这样一件事,有多少热爱写作的人,认认真真写的文无人问津,无奈之下只能帮别人
东方阔爱
·
2024-02-09 12:04
利用低代码 BI 平台获得竞争优势:实现数据分析与业务决策的革新
介绍疫情迫使企业
优先
考虑数字化转型。由于公司被迫参加计划外的数字化速成课程,这种文化转变将数字技术的采用加速了数年。转向数字解决方案已成倍增加了跨行业生成的数据量。
ZOHO卓豪
·
2024-02-09 11:47
低代码
数据分析
数据挖掘
LeetCode 热题 100 | 链表(下)
目录1148.排序链表223.合并K个升序链表3146.LRU缓存3.1解题思路3.2详细过程3.3完整代码菜鸟做题第三周,语言是C++1148.排序链表解题思路:
遍历
链表,把每个节点的val都存入数组中用
狂放不羁霸
·
2024-02-09 11:43
力扣
leetcode
链表
算法
大学python笔记整理_python 笔记整理
enumerate()函数用于将一个可
遍历
的数据对象(如列表、元组或字符串)组合为一个索引序列,同时列出数据和数据下标,一般用在for循环当中。
余虹的眼
·
2024-02-09 11:04
大学python笔记整理
【LeetCode】1768.交替合并字符串
二、解题思路1.双指针1)i,j分别指向字符串word1,word2;2)循环
遍历
word1,word2,只要i,j均
遍历
完成2.单指针其实,只要一个指针就可以搞定,而且
遍历
次数最多Math.min(word
JAY-CHOW
·
2024-02-09 11:28
leetcode
算法
java
C语言——oj刷题——调整数组使奇数全部都位于偶数前面
然后,我们可以使用循环来
遍历
数组,直到两个指针相遇为止。在每次循环中,我们检
朝九晚五ฺ
·
2024-02-09 11:26
算法
数据结构
排序算法
Java8对list集合进行排序、过滤、分组、去重、转map、
遍历
赋值等操作
//xxx表示你需要去重的字段列如(o->o.id())返回已经去重集合ListnameDistinct=list.stream().collect(Collectors.collectingAndThen(Collectors.toCollection(()->newTreeSetxxx))),ArrayList::new));//通过多个字段去重,返回已经去重集合ListdistinctCla
rainbowz
·
2024-02-09 11:27
VueDiff算法对比ReactDiff算法区别
然后用新的树和旧的树进行比较(diff),记录两棵树差异3.把第二棵树所记录的差异应用到第一棵树所构建的真正的DOM树上(patch),视图就更新了比较方式:diff整体策略为:深度
优先
,同层比较特点一
Clavin.
·
2024-02-09 11:21
算法
javascript
前端
CANalyzer及CANOE使用六:VH6501干扰仪的使用(busoff多种干扰/短路/采样点)
(Demo版)四、CAPL函数干扰五、采样点测试(Demo版和CAPL函数)基于14229+15765的UDS或Bootloader培训一、培训内容:14229服务含义,功能应用场景,正响应,负响应,
优先
级等
YMX随笔
·
2024-02-09 10:49
canoe脚本capl
VH6501干扰
采样点
can
【大厂AI课学习笔记】【1.5 AI技术领域】(9)机器翻译
成功的关键:能够
优先
解决对自然语言的正确认知与辨识。应用主要场景:在线多语言翻译语音同传翻译机跨语
giszz
·
2024-02-09 10:17
人工智能
学习笔记
人工智能
学习
笔记
react中的diff算法
diff算法对于React团队发现在日常开发中对于更新组件的频率,会比新增和删除的频率更高,所以在diff算法里,判断更新的
优先
级会更高。
_处女座程序员的日常
·
2024-02-09 10:45
js
前端
React
react.js
算法
javascript
寒假作业-day6
1>请编程实现二又树的操作1.1二又树的创建1.2二又树的先序
遍历
1.3二又树的中序
遍历
1.4二又树的后序
遍历
1.5二又树各个节点度的个数1.6
二叉树的深度
代码:#include#include#includetypedefchardatatype
木 每
·
2024-02-09 10:05
算法
数据结构
代码随想录算法训练营第38天(动态规划01 ● 理论基础 ● 509. 斐波那契数 ● 70. 爬楼梯 ● 746. 使用最小花费爬楼梯
理论基础理论基础讲解视频讲解动态规划中每一个状态一定是由上一个状态推导出来的,这一点就区分于贪心,贪心没有状态推导,而是从局部直接选最优的动态规划五步曲确定dp数组(dptable)以及下标的含义确定递推公式dp数组如何初始化确定
遍历
顺序举例推导
芋泥肉松脑袋
·
2024-02-09 10:31
算法
动态规划
数据结构
java
leetcode
代码随想录算法训练营第41天(动态规划03 ● 343. 整数拆分 ● 96.不同的二叉搜索树
确定递推公式j是从1开始
遍历
,拆分j的情况,在
遍历
j的过程中其实都计算过了。那么从1
遍历
j,比较(i-j)*j和dp[i-j]*
芋泥肉松脑袋
·
2024-02-09 10:58
算法
动态规划
数据结构
开发语言
java
长篇科幻连载:《奴星记》第二十五章 “孕囊”
说明:本科幻小说由作者鹏戈所写,
优先
发表在作者个人博客19842001.com上,会比在上的更新速度更快。
科幻星鹏
·
2024-02-09 10:11
146、LRU 缓存 | 算法(leetcode,附思维导图 + 全部解法)300题
//技巧:遇到O(1)的get、put操作,
优先
考虑哈希表(JS里的Map数据结构)。
码农三少
·
2024-02-09 10:40
2024年华为OD机试真题-内存冷热标记-Java-OD统一考试(C卷)
题目描述:现代计算机系统中通常存在多级的存储设备,针对海量workload的优化的一种思路是将热点内存页
优先
放到快速存储层级,这就需要对内存页进行冷热标记。
2023面试高手
·
2024-02-09 10:46
华为od
java
算法
开发语言
华中师范大学计算机考研874攻略
语言程序设计参考书目《数据结构及应用算法教程》(修订版)严蔚敏、陈文博清华大学出版社2011-5-9《C语言程序设计教程(第二版)》王敬华清华大学出版社2009-8-1874考试大纲第一部分:C语言程序设计各种运算符、
优先
级和结合性数据类型及与表示范围格式化输入
chengcheng874
·
2024-02-09 09:42
【记录】Python3|json文件处理相关的操作
文章目录json分割json.gz转换成jsonl.gzjson格式化显示
遍历
目录及子目录,对某种类型的文件内容查找是否有指定字符串json分割主要使用json.loads、json.dump。
shandianchengzi
·
2024-02-09 09:37
代码
#
琐碎小记录
python
json
【算法集训专题攻克篇】第五篇之双指针
☀️短短几行代码,凝聚无数前人智慧;一个普通循环,即是解题之眼☀️ 二分,贪心,并查集,二叉树,图论,深度
优先
搜索(dfs),宽度
优先
搜索(bfs),数论,动态规划等等,路漫漫
梦想new的出来
·
2024-02-09 09:04
算法集训
算法
c++
深度优先
图解数据结构C++版 - (02) - 图论
目录2图论2.1图的概念(1)图的定义(2)图的基本术语2.2图的存储结构(1)邻接矩阵(2)邻接表存储方法(3)简化的连接表【题1】LeetCode997:找到小镇的法官2.3图的
遍历
【题2】LeetCode100
几度春风里
·
2024-02-09 09:32
C++
c++
数据结构
图论
C++算法之递归与递推(1)
一、递归(所有递归=>递归搜索树)1.求斐波拉且数列分析过程执行是前序
遍历
,回溯是后序
遍历
,和栈的思想相同,先进后出代码实现#includeusingnamespacestd;intf(intn){if
算法下的星辰曲
·
2024-02-09 09:01
蓝桥杯
算法
c++
数据结构
xib自适应布局总结
1、ContentHuggingPriority:抗拉伸
优先
级,值越小,视图越容易被拉伸2、ContentCompressionResistance视图抗压缩
优先
级,值越小,视图越容易被压缩3、运用场景
huoshe2019
·
2024-02-09 09:27
9.6整数拆分(LC343-M)
其实可以从1
遍历
j,然后有两种渠道得到dp[i].一个是j*(i-j)直接相乘。一个是j*dp[i-j],相当于是拆分(i-j),对这个拆分不理解的话,可以回想dp数组的定义。
pig不会cv
·
2024-02-09 09:53
#
9.动态规划
动态规划
算法
Vue2中v-for 与 v-if 的
优先
级
但是,当我们在同一个元素上同时使用这两个指令时,就需要注意它们的
优先
级关系了。首先,让我们了解一下v-for和v-if的基本用法。v-for是Vue的内置指令,用于循环渲染数组或对象。
JJCTO
·
2024-02-09 09:21
Vue
vue.js
javascript
ecmascript
爬虫(二)
1.同步获取短视频1.只要播放地址对Json数据解析,先把列表找出:2.只想要所有的播放地址,通过列表表达式循环
遍历
这个列表拿到每个对象,再从一个个对象里面找到Video,再从Video里面找到播放地址
Stara0511
·
2024-02-09 08:34
python
mysql
crawler
cookie
我是如何一步一步爬上 「64K限制」 的坑
大部分人都会按照这样的步骤处理:遇到一个BUG,
优先
按照自己经验修复;修复不了,开始Google(不要百度,再三强调),寻找一切和我们BUG相似的问题,然后看看有没有解决方案;尝试了很多解决方案,a方案不行换
Android之禅
·
2024-02-09 08:27
Github 2024-02-08 开源项目日报 Top9
1Python项目1Scala项目1PLpgSQL项目1Rust项目1NASL项目1C项目1TypeScript项目1非开发语言项目1Clojure项目1JupyterNotebook项目1Logseq:隐私
优先
的开源知识管理
孙琦Ray
·
2024-02-09 08:22
github
开源
Github趋势分析
开源项目
Python
Golang
代码随想录算法训练营DAY16 | 二叉树 (3)
LeetCode104二叉树的最大深度题目链接:104.二叉树的最大深度https://leetcode.cn/problems/maximum-depth-of-binary-tree/思路:采用后序
遍历
递归求解
橙南花已开
·
2024-02-09 08:50
代码随想录算法训练营
算法
代码随想录算法训练营DAY15 | 二叉树 (2)
一、LeetCode102二叉树的层序
遍历
题目链接:102.二叉树的层序
遍历
https://leetcode.cn/problems/binary-tree-level-order-traversal/
橙南花已开
·
2024-02-09 08:20
代码随想录算法训练营
算法
华为机试od社招刷题攻略-三数之和
三个数依次从小到大排序.输入10519616输出1510169输入3216输出123思路需要查找三个数,最简单的就是三层循环
遍历
,查找所有的组合方式并判断。技巧提示:当
微凉的风啊
·
2024-02-09 08:49
数据结构和算法
算法
【筱赧科普快递93】如何避免每逢佳节胖三斤
餐桌上多选鱼虾贝类清蒸、水煮可以
优先
选择,其次各种酱牛肉,炖鸡块,炒里脊也不错;然后,各种爽口凉拌菜,蘸酱菜可以大吃特吃。主食早晚可以熬点八宝粥,串门中餐菜
邓普利多赧
·
2024-02-09 08:36
Java算法练习4
Java算法练习41.1[145.二叉树的后序
遍历
](https://leetcode.cn/problems/binary-tree-postorder-traversal/)1.2[173.二叉搜索树迭代器
It_张
·
2024-02-09 08:10
算法练习
Java
java
算法
开发语言
之前看过的前序
遍历
的线索二叉树感觉写的有点问题 这里更新一下我的思路
datatypeData;structBitNode*leftchild;structBitNode*rightchild;intlefttag;intrighttag;}Node;#pragmaregion前序线索化递归
遍历
今天我刷leetcode了吗
·
2024-02-09 08:39
算法
树的全部应用
树的
遍历
以及树的线索化创建结点中序递归
遍历
后序递归
遍历
先序递归
遍历
输出二叉树的叶子结点中序
遍历
输出二叉树的叶子结点后序
遍历
输出二叉树的叶子结点统计叶子结点的数目分治计算叶子结点求二叉树的高度先序
遍历
二叉树的非递归中序
遍历
二叉树的非递归后序
遍历
二叉树的非递归先序线索化二叉树后序线索化二叉树中序线索化二叉树创建结点
今天我刷leetcode了吗
·
2024-02-09 08:09
算法
数据结构
中序
遍历
线索化二叉树以及最终实现结果
中序
遍历
线索化二叉树思路分析voidInOrderCuleTree(node*root){if(root==null){cout#includeusingnamespacestd;typedefintdatatype
今天我刷leetcode了吗
·
2024-02-09 08:09
c++
开发语言
【Python】字符串总结
【Python】字符串总结定义类型转换
优先
掌握的操作1.按索引取值(正向取,反向取):2.成员运算in和notin3.strip移除字符串首尾指定的字符(默认移除空格)4.split切分字符串获得列表5
何为xl
·
2024-02-09 07:39
python
python
开发语言
后端
2018-09-14java学习
方法一:
遍历
数组的传统方法方法二:
遍历
Collection对象的传统方法方法三:简单方式(1.5开始提供的for循环写法)Java采用“for”(而不是意义更明确的“foreach”)来引导这种一般被叫做
Xmaxdev
·
2024-02-09 07:06
odoo看板
QWeb前言:Qweb是odoo使用的模板引擎,基于xml来生成HTML片段和页面.通过Qweb可生成丰富的看板视图,报表和cmx一·了解看板两种布局#1.卡片列表#2.组织成不同的卡片二·设计看板视图
优先
级
「已注销」
·
2024-02-09 07:33
odoo
python
JQuery学习二
JQuery学习二文章目录前言一、操作DOM1.1.文档对象模型DOM1.2.DOM
遍历
1.3.删除元素二、事件2.1.事件处理2.2.事件对象2.3.创建待办事件列表三、效果3.1.显示/隐藏,淡入,
星石传说
·
2024-02-09 07:26
python篇
jquery
学习
前端
Java基础常见面试题总结-集合(二)
Iterator模式用同一种逻辑来
遍历
集合。它可以把访问逻辑从不同类型的集合类中抽象出来,不需要了解集合内部实现便可以
遍历
集合元素,统一使用Iterator提供的接口去
遍历
。
此花本应与她
·
2024-02-09 06:28
java
LeetCode刷题笔记(Java实现)-- 22. 括号生成
示例1:输入:n=3输出:[“((()))”,“(()())”,“(())()”,“()(())”,“()()()”]示例2:输入:n=1输出:[“()”]算法思路:深度
优先
遍历
+回溯法1.lc,rc分别表示当前左括号和右括号的个数
挽风归
·
2024-02-09 06:26
java
算法
leetcode
下一个排列
31.下一个排列-力扣(LeetCode)思路1.从右向左
遍历
数组,找到第一个满足`nums[i]=0&&nums[i]>=nums[i+1]){i--;}if(i>=0){intj=n-1;//从后往前
Sloent
·
2024-02-09 06:53
算法
算法
数据结构
java
力扣
排序算法
OCCT几何内核开发-brep数据结构
OpenCascade提供了TopExp_Explorer类,可以
遍历
模型中的face、edge等。
stonewu
·
2024-02-09 06:47
occt
几何内核
brep
Java 的 多线程&JUC
并发和并行多线程的实现方式多线程的第一种实现方式多线程的第二种实现方式多线程的第三种实现方式小结多线程中常见的成员方法常用简单方法线程的
优先
级守护线程(备胎线程)礼让线程和插入线程(了解)线程的生命周期线程安全的问题同步代码块同步方法
三池丶
·
2024-02-09 06:38
java
jvm
开发语言
YOLOv8算法改进【NO.91】引入RCS-YOLO算法模块
前言YOLO算法改进系列出到这,很多朋友问改进如何选择是最佳的,下面我就根据个人多年的写作发文章以及指导发文章的经验来看,按照
优先
顺序进行排序讲解YOLO算法改进方法的顺序选择。
人工智能算法研究院
·
2024-02-09 06:35
首发创新改进方法
YOLO算法改进系列
YOLO
算法
transformer
JUC - 多线程之Synchronized和Lock锁;生产者消费者模式(一)
MinggeQingchun的博客-CSDN博客Java--多线程之终止/中断线程(二)_MinggeQingchun的博客-CSDN博客_java中断线程Java--多线程之join,yield,sleep;线程
优先
级
MinggeQingchun
·
2024-02-09 06:33
JavaSE
Java多线程;JUC
JUC
多线程
上一页
39
40
41
42
43
44
45
46
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他